    Hi
    Can anyone recommend an specialist Ferrari insurer as many insures wont touch me as I have no experience in a supercar e.g Porsche, Ferrari etc

    I'm 52 no convictions.

    I do not have any NCB bonus as used on other cars.

    I have tried Adrian Flux, Classic Line which will not quote me. Peter Best insurance want £8000.

    I did however get a quote from Admiral which was £620.

    Any help would be appreciated.

    Basically a lot of the insurers want you to have one years insurance/experience on a supercar.

    They would not consider a owner of say an Audi RS or BMW M car, as these too are not considered as superars despite some being more powerful.
